赞
踩
首先想到的是输入一个数,然后提取它的各个位数。比如123先分别提取他的个十百位,然后再乘1,10,100;
所以我们来个例题,比如输入700,输出7,前面的零不显示。
- #include<stdio.h>
- int main()
- {
- int a,g,s,b,q;
- scanf("%d",&a);
- g=a%10;
- s=a/10%10;
- b=a/100%10;
- q=b+10*s+100*g;
- printf("%d",q);
- return 0;
- }
可以得到代码输出的结果是7。
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。